Description

Eastwood Burn Out Blue Metallic - This classic medium blue metallic is understated and simple, yet it remains a favorite year after year.

Eastwood's premium Single-Stage Acrylic Urethane Topcoat provides exceptional long-lasting beauty and durability.

  • Catalyzed urethane for unsurpassed durability
  • Highly resistant to UV rays, chemicals, chips
  • Makes 1 sprayable gallon when mixed 3:1 with a required activator
  • Approximate coverage: 125 SQ FT
  • Flake/Pearl Particle size: 10-60 microns
  • Max Temperature: Paint will handle up to 300 degrees without delamination, but color shift may occur, so it should not be used in a high heat setting
  • Made in the USA

This premium 2-component topcoat system is blended with top-quality raw materials and advanced composition coatings technology. Superior to acrylic, alkyd and lacquer coatings. Eastwood's single-stage urethane paints hold their gloss longer and won't yellow.

    Im going to clear it, how long do I need to let it cure before I can?

    Asked by: Ballzmckgee
    You may optionally clearcoat with any of Eastwood’s Urethane clear coats after the final coat has flashed, but before 18 hours have passed. After 18 hours the surface must be abraded with 400 - 600 grit before clear coating. Flash-off Time 5 - 10 min. at 20°C (68°F). Dry Times 15 - 20 min. at 20°C (68°F). Can be taped after 8 hours. Wait 12 hours to polish. Wait 18 hours to handle. If recoating after 18 hours, first the surface must be abraded.

    3:1 Burnout Blue Metallic - Single Stage need Clear coat?

    Asked by: alfred
    Thank you for your question: Single stage paints do not require a clear coat, however for more deep gloss and more UV protection a clear coat can be sprayed over single stage paints.
